sql入門新手教程 本人菜鳥,剛剛裝好Oracle11g,不知道如何啟動數(shù)據(jù)庫,請高手指點,謝謝?
本人菜鳥,剛剛裝好Oracle11g,不知道如何啟動數(shù)據(jù)庫,請高手指點,謝謝?在Windows下:輸入命令行:Net start oracleserviceorcl(下面的orcl是您安裝的數(shù)據(jù)庫實例
本人菜鳥,剛剛裝好Oracle11g,不知道如何啟動數(shù)據(jù)庫,請高手指點,謝謝?
在Windows下:輸入命令行:Net start oracleserviceorcl(下面的orcl是您安裝的數(shù)據(jù)庫實例的名稱)
提示打開sqlplus/as SYSDBA
在Linux下:Oracle user login
sqlplus/as SYSDBA
startup
oracle?DBA需要掌握哪些技巧?
要成為優(yōu)秀的DBA,除了數(shù)據(jù)庫本身的技術能力外,還要掌握一些其他技術,如操作系統(tǒng)、網(wǎng)絡、虛擬化、存儲。。。因為它的許多領域是相互聯(lián)系、密不可分的
!數(shù)據(jù)庫技術:您需要了解以下幾個方面
第一:SQL語句和PLSQL語句
第二:體系結構(數(shù)據(jù)庫安裝、卸載和升級;數(shù)據(jù)庫啟動和關閉;偵聽器和TNS概念;文件、內存、進程概念,以及它們如何協(xié)同工作;表空間、段、段、數(shù)據(jù))塊概念和關系;SCN和檢查審核等)
第三:備份和恢復(冷備份、熱備份和RMAN備份)
第四:性能優(yōu)化(執(zhí)行計劃、跟蹤、10046事件、掛起分析、索引、分區(qū)、SQL優(yōu)化、AWR報告和其他性能分析工具、等待事件等)
第五:高可用性(DataGuard、RAC、GoldenGate)
希望我能為您的回答提供幫助
零基礎的人如何學習Java?
我已經(jīng)使用java很長時間了,并且已經(jīng)出版了關于java的書籍,所以讓我談談學習java的過程。
java學習的重點是web開發(fā),學習的難點是對java面向對象概念的理解。學習java需要一個系統(tǒng)的過程,在學習java的不同階段需要做不同的準備。下面是一個描述(以web開發(fā)為例)。
在第一階段,我為自己設定了方向。例如,我想在將來做web開發(fā)或Android開發(fā)。當我有了方向,我自然知道我的重點是什么。畢竟,編程語言是一種工具,所以在學習工具之前我需要知道該怎么做。
第二階段是開始了解Java的語法細節(jié)。此階段的準備工作是構建開發(fā)環(huán)境并安裝JDK。在學習初期,建議使用記事本編程,鍛煉程序員的手寫代碼能力,并在編程初期養(yǎng)成一些好習慣。
第三階段是開始學習web開發(fā)。在這個階段,我們需要準備數(shù)據(jù)庫知識和一些前端知識。數(shù)據(jù)庫產品可以選擇mysql,mysql也是一種應用廣泛的數(shù)據(jù)庫產品。
第四階段開始學習框架開發(fā)。框架開發(fā)可以節(jié)省大量的開發(fā)時間。目前,springmvc得到了廣泛的應用。
第五階段開始實習。實習對程序員的成長有很大的幫助。通過實際項目的磨練,我們將更全面地掌握編程語言。